About This Item
Pasadena: Baxter Art Gallery, California Institute of Technology, 1980. First Edition . Soft cover. Very Good. Very Good copy featuring the work of Frank Gehry (cardboard furniture), Lynda Benglis, Guy Dill, Robert Irwin, Tony DeLap and others. Features work by 8 artists with Brogan fabrication or technical assistance. Laid in is a 2006 exhibition announcement for "Cardboard" at the Bobbie Greenfield Gallery at Bergamot Station featuring Easy Edges Furniture by Jack Brogan, Frank Gehry and Robert Irwin.
